Essoyes, Grand Est, France
20.5 miles (33.0 km) · 2,168 ft elevation gain · Loop · trail · Route
Tour des Maquisards is a 20.5-mile loop route in Essoyes, Grand Est, France, gaining 2,168 feet of elevation. The route follows a up-and-over elevation profile. The terrain breaks into 6 distinct sections including 3 significant climbs. The longest climb covers 3.2 miles gaining 513 feet at an average 4.4% grade. Approximately 84% of the route is runnable at a steady effort. The route opens with a descent and finishes with a climb.
